The Castle Maria Loretto is located in the eastern bay of Lake Wörth on the peninsula Maria Loretto, next to the mouth of the Lendkanal . After the castle had been owned by the Orsini-Rosenberg family since it was built, the city of Klagenfurt acquired it at the end of 2002. The building and park were renovated in 2007 and made accessible to the public. A private company operates an event center here for festive occasions.

Right next to the castle is a public seaside swimming pool, which used to be part of the castle park, as well as a restaurant in the castle's former farm building. Around 1840 an avenue led from today's campsite over the castle park to the shore of the Wörthersee.

history

In 1650 Johann Andreas von Rosenberg acquired the peninsula and in 1652 had a large castle built with a crown of free-standing towers and magnificent portals. In 1708, a fire destroyed most of this complex, only the remains of free-standing towers have been preserved. A tower still stands on the grounds of the seaside resort today. The building erected afterwards is much simpler. The splendid bridges have also disappeared, because the island was turned into a peninsula by backfill and siltation. The detailed history of the peninsula, recorded in three handwritten volumes by the respective castle owners, is in the possession of a previous owner and co-owner of the castle.

architecture

The castle visible today is a building from the 18th century, which is a massive but simple building with an almost square floor plan. The Maria Loretto Chapel, originally completed in 1660 and renovated after a fire in 1768, stands on the massive retaining walls facing the Lend Canal. The location of the castle on the protruding peninsula offers an excellent view over the Wörthersee.
